Tuesday Is National Night Out (23rd District)

37 million people did it last year, worldwide... will you be one of them this year? Tonight is NATIONAL NIGHT OUT and both the 20th and 23rd police districts have activities planned. First, the 23rd:


Clarendon Park Neighbors says: "7pm at Clarendon Park (Clarendon and Sunnyside) - Join your neighbors and CAPS police officers. CAPS supplies the hot dogs and drinks -- you can bring your smiling face and even a side dish! If you can't make it to the Park on Tuesday night, please participate in National Night Out by sitting outside of your building to show that you are the eyes and ears on the street."

Please note that this event is in lieu of the CAPS meeting that's usually at Truman College tonight. All the same police officers and beat facilitator will be there, so if you have concerns, please don't hesitate to bring it up to them.

Also -- Space Jam will be playing at Gill Park, 825 W Sheridan, as a Movie in the Park.  It begins at dusk.
